Receive Output Mute: Writing a “1” to this bit, mutes receive
outputs at RPOS/RDATA and RNEG/LCV pins to a “0” state for
any channel that detects an RLOS condition.
N
Extended LOS: Writing a “1” to this bit extends the number of
zeros at the receive input of each channel before RLOS is
declared to 4096 bits. Writing a “0” reverts to the normal mode
(175+75 bits for T1 and 32 bits for E1).
In-Circuit-Testing: Writing a “1” to this bit configures all the
output pins of the chip in high impedance mode for In-Circuit-
Testing. Setting the ICT bit to “1” is equivalent to connecting
the Hardware ICT pin 88 to ground.
